The type of acne skin care product you might use would come under three general categories:
- Preventive
- Over-the-Counter: Treatments for conditions that do not require prescription
- Prescription only: doctors or dermatologists prescribe special treatments
Probably the largest part of the skin care market is products that are designed to clean and protect the skin from acne occurring, like skin cleansers. In the real sense, these products are just those that should be part of your daily routine.
There are acne skin care products that are more specialized in there approach and are formulated to reduce and limit the amount of oil in the pores of our skin. These types of products are reducing the chance of oil staying in the pores and aiding the growth of harmful bacteria which assists the formation of the skin condition.
One particular skin care treatment is an exfoliation skin peel which cleans the skin and helps control the spread of the condition. The peels clean the skin by removing all surface pollution and dead skin cells which can block the pores.
Many different, specially formulated acne skin care products designed to reduce the problems have now been made available without prescription. Products that contain the chemical benzoyl peroxide and the naturally occurring salicylic acid are used in vanishing creams. They work by removing the excess oil from the skin and halt the growth of acne.
You should start with a product that has lower concentration of benzoyl peroxide (e.g. 5%) and see how your skin responds. Alpha-hydroxy-acid based moisturizers are also popular as a skin care regime. It is not always possible to find an acne skin care product that works first time. You may need to try a few but if none of them seem to be working then you would be advised to contact your skin specialist.

On-prescription treatments are prescribed by a dermatologist and can include ointments that can be applied on the affected area or oral antibiotics or just any topical ointment. In more serious cases your skin care specialist may decide that a small surgical procedure can be used to remove the oil and infection from your pores. You are warned never to attempt this yourself as it could lead to serious skin problems.
An alternative that has been shown to work well is hormone therapy. Studies have shown that hormones can cause acne and skin care treatments that are hormone based have proved to be effective in many cases.
